There are some basic tools you will need for cleaning the car seats:

  • Vacuum with an upholstery brush
  • Rigidscrub
  • Fine synthetic fibre
  • Sponge
  • Bucket
  • Spray bottle

Fabric car seat cleaning: best methodsFabric car seat cleaning 7 best methods

1. Proceed by vacuuming:

To begin sterilising your cloth car seats, begin by cleaning up the cloth. This will get rid of dirt particles, and pet hair from the seat cover instead of trying to push it deeper into the covering. Achieve between the rear and the front seat in your vacuum. Then, with the furnishings brush, lift the cloth fibres.

2. Apply the cleaning solution:

You may have to mix the rubbing alcohol with warm water based on the cleanser you chose. Please refer to the product label of the cleanser to understand how to use it. The cleaning solution should be applied gently so that you can control how much gets on the cloth.

3. Use a brush to clean the car seats:

Soak the stains afterwards scrubbing them as thoroughly as you can. With the brush, you can kind of rub the seat to get rid of the stains. You may need to purchase a soft or moderate brush specifically for this. You risk damaging your seat if you use an excessively stiff brush, like a rug brush. Try to be aware of the brush you’re using is just too harsh or too soft to prevent this.

4. Use a microfiber cloth to rub everything down:

The cloth can be massaged to assist in pulling dirt to the surfaces. Use a microfibre cloth to sweep away the grimy stains. Before it sets, which would cause the filth to reappear on the seat, be careful. Ensure that the material is spotless and won’t exacerbate the staining issue on your car seats. Utilizing a light-coloured soft cloth makes it easier to determine whether or not the stain is being removed.

5. Repeat each step if necessary:

Repeat the procedure if the cushion still appears dirty. If a cushion is exceedingly dirty (instead of when it has earlier been managed to clean), going over it and repeating the process several times will yield exceptional results.

6. Once you’re done, vacuum again:

After you’ve successfully cleaned the stain, vacuum once again to let any extremely wet spots dry up. It won’t take too long to do this. All you need to do is quickly vacuum your car seat to be ready to go. But try to wait until everything has dried before getting back into the car.

8. Let the seats air-dry:

Before operating the car once more, let the seats have ample time to dry thoroughly. Normally, 2-3 hours should pass. If necessary hasten the procedure and direct a powerful fan in the vehicle’s direction of seats.

Fabric Car Seats: How to Maintain Their Cleanliness Fabric car seats How to Maintain Their Cleanliness

1. Regularly vacuum your cloth car seats:

Regularly vacuum the fabric of car seats so that dirt and debris vanish. If your car has a lot of dirt inside, consider vacuuming it once a week to twice a week. This number would depend on who sits in the car. If you have kids or pets in your house, it is a good exercise to vacuum the car regularly.

2. As soon as a spill or stain occurs, clean it up:

Cleaning up spills as soon as they occur is another approach to help prevent stains on your cotton vehicle seats. Additionally, you must promptly remove any debris that leaves stains, such as grease, blood, or mud.

3. Put vehicle seat coverings on:

When you eat in your car, keep the sheet wedged beneath your chair. For spills, the washcloth will also function as a mat. It is an excellent practice to always have seat coverings on as it acts as a protective shield. It would help in keeping the seats clean and also protect the seats last longer.
